I am used to Panasonic plasma for 6 yrs. Main use is for movies on tata sky, prime vdo and Netflix , all in full HD. Picture quality is really good and not very bright, subtle colours with natural looks.
I am planning new 4k HDR TV.
I watched full HD movies and 4k contents in showroom. Just few points=
*4k content on LG C8 OLED is the best.
*4k content on LED 4K is awesome, but inferior to OLED.
*FULL HD content on OLED is good.
*Full HD content on 4k LED is not up to mark. I watched mainly on LG UK series TV and Samsung qled. Colour tone is not natural. It looks very artificial. Full HD content on my Panasonic plasma is way better. Sony F90 LED full HD content was relatively better than Samsung, LG but still inferior to plasma.
I am confused whether to upgrade tv or not?
Am I missing something? Its full HD content (upscaled to 4k) that we will be watching most of the time as pure 4k content is not yet so readily available. Kindly opine.
